The 5-Second Trick For pg เว็บตรง

If you probably did commence The brand new cluster, it's prepared to shared files and it is actually unsafe to utilize the aged cluster. The outdated cluster will need to be restored from backup In such cases.

If you are trying to automate the upgrade of numerous clusters, you should notice that clusters with equivalent database schemas call for the identical article-upgrade ways for all cluster upgrades; this is because the write-up-up grade measures are based upon the databases schemas, instead of consumer data.

clearly, nobody needs to be accessing the clusters during the update. pg_upgrade defaults to operating servers on port 50432 to prevent unintended customer connections.

Major PostgreSQL releases on a regular basis increase new functions that often alter the format in the procedure tables, but The interior facts storage format almost never changes. pg_upgrade makes use of this actuality to carry out speedy updates by creating new system tables and easily reusing the previous person information documents.

(Tablespaces and pg_wal is often on different file methods.) Clone manner presents precisely the same speed and disk Place benefits but won't trigger the previous cluster to get unusable when the new cluster is begun. Clone manner also needs the previous and new knowledge directories be in the same file method. This manner is just readily available on certain working programs and file systems.

They all bring on downloadable PDFs – at least from where I Are living (Australia). whenever they don’t give you the results you want, try accessing them through an nameless proxy server.

pg_upgrade launches small-lived postmasters in the old and new details directories. short-term Unix socket files for communication with these postmasters are, by default, produced in the current Operating directory. In some scenarios the path identify for The existing directory could possibly be far too extended to get a valid socket name.

It's also possible to specify user and port values, and whether or not you'd like the info documents linked or cloned instead of the default duplicate conduct.

Establish The brand new PostgreSQL supply with configure flags that happen to be appropriate Together with the previous cluster. pg_upgrade will check pg_controldata to be certain all settings are suitable before beginning the update.

If an mistake occurs although restoring the database schema, pg_upgrade will exit and you will need to revert on the aged cluster as outlined in action seventeen underneath. to test pg_upgrade yet again, you must modify the outdated cluster Therefore the pg_upgrade schema restore succeeds.

the outdated and new cluster directories within the standby. The Listing framework below the specified directories on the principal and standbys need to match. seek advice from the rsync guide web site for particulars on specifying the remote Listing, e.g.,

Should get more info your set up Listing just isn't Model-distinct, e.g., /usr/nearby/pgsql, it is necessary to maneuver the current PostgreSQL put in Listing so it doesn't interfere While using the new PostgreSQL installation.

Listing to use for postmaster sockets during upgrade; default is current Doing work directory; setting variable PGSOCKETDIR

If the thing is everything during the documentation that is not right, isn't going to match your experience with the particular feature or needs even further clarification, remember to use this type to report a documentation problem.

The brand new PostgreSQL executable directory; default will be the Listing exactly where pg_upgrade resides; surroundings variable PGBINNEW

Leave a Reply

Your email address will not be published. Required fields are marked *